In Time Ace, players assume the role of Dr. Hugo Clock, a peace-loving scientist who has invented a time machine with the intention of preventing World War I from happening. Before he can act on his altruistic plan, the time machine is stolen by his meddling assistant, Klaus Scythe, who begins to unleash an assault on the world using powerful weaponry stolen from the future. As the only other person who knows of the time machine's existence, Dr. Clock must take to the skies and travel through time to put an end to Scythe's scheme once and for all.
Time Ace puts the history of combat aircraft at players' fingertips as they battle through nine unique periods of time to stop Scythe. From World War I biplanes to contemporary jet fighters and even the supersonic aircraft of the future, players will be able to customize their aircraft's firepower, speed and maneuverability as they blast through waves of enemies. The game's fully 3D environments allow for exploration and free-form completion of each stage's goals, encouraging players to look for secret power-ups and attack enemies from a variety of strategic vantage points.
In addition to the single player story mode, Time Ace lets players go head-to-head with multiplayer dogfighting and a variety of mini-games such as racing and obstacle courses. Up to four players can participate in each game type via a local wireless connection.
